Expert Advice: Dog Breeds How Many Types of Retrievers Are There? Get to Know All Six Breeds
Originally bred to help hunters, retrievers were tasked with finding birds or other game and bringing them back undamaged. For this sort of job, the dog needed a “soft,” gentle mouth, where they would carefully carry the prey without damaging it. Legislative Alerts Texas: Express Opposition NOW to Bill Allowing Quick Termination of Your Ownership Rights
Texas House Bill 1083 seeks to provide for the quick termination of ownership rights in animals that are impounded by an animal shelter.  Instead of a uniform statewide minimum holding period before ownership rights would be terminated, as is customary in other states, HB 1083 would let local governments set a holding period for such […]

Legislative Alerts Nevada: Ask Committee to Support Ban on Insurance Breed Discrimination on Wednesday (4/21)
The Nevada Assembly Commerce and Labor Committee is considering a bill on Wednesday, April 21, that would prohibit homeowner’s, renter’s and mobile home insurance or vehicle umbrella insurance providers from refusing or cancelling coverage or increasing premiums based solely on the breed of dog owned by the policy holder.
